Stefano Goria is a scholar working on Experimental and Cognitive Psychology, Cognitive Neuroscience and Social Psychology. According to data from OpenAlex, Stefano Goria has authored 7 papers receiving a total of 51 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Experimental and Cognitive Psychology, 2 papers in Cognitive Neuroscience and 1 paper in Social Psychology. Recurrent topics in Stefano Goria's work include Emotion and Mood Recognition (2 papers), Dementia and Cognitive Impairment Research (1 paper) and Particle physics theoretical and experimental studies (1 paper). Stefano Goria is often cited by papers focused on Emotion and Mood Recognition (2 papers), Dementia and Cognitive Impairment Research (1 paper) and Particle physics theoretical and experimental studies (1 paper). Stefano Goria collaborates with scholars based in United Kingdom, Italy and Brazil. Stefano Goria's co-authors include Giampiero Passarino, Nicholas Cummins, Alexandra L. Georgescu, Taylor Kuhn, Agnes Norbury and Giulio Falcioni and has published in prestigious journals such as Scientific Reports, Nuclear Physics B and JMIR Formative Research.
